  • the invention relates to a rod guide for guiding locking bars on sheet metal cabinet doors od.
  • a rod guide for guiding locking bars on sheet metal cabinet doors od.
  • a fixable on the inner surface of the door leaf as yakmadeten carrier, and a mountable on the carrier
  • a housing performing guide element with a guide surface whose distance from the inner surface of the door panel is adjustable with mounted rod
  • the doted on the door leaf carrier is a stud with peripheral thread on which stud bolts an adjusting screw or adjusting nut is screwed or screwed, and wherein the adjusting screw or the adjusting nut is rotatably mounted on or in the guide element.
  • Such a rod guide is already known, see DE 202007 005424 U1.
  • a disadvantage of this known design of a rod guide with adjustability is the fact that the application of a screw or nut on the stud and adjustment of the distance of the guide surface to the door wall is cumbersome.
  • the adjusting screw is arranged next to the rod, which leads to tilting forces.
  • the known rod guide needs a lot of space, which is often not available.
  • Another disadvantage is that a tool, namely a screwdriver is necessary for adjusting the adjusting nut.
  • the object of the invention is to avoid these disadvantages and to provide a rod guide, the rotation of the with a few turns and without tools Adjusting screw or nut by hand, requires less space and leads the rod coaxial with the support as welding studs.
  • the adjusting screw or adjusting nut has an externally accessible, roughened or grooved or folded peripheral surface for rotating the adjusting nut or screw by hand.
  • the housing forms one or two opposing openings, through which the peripheral surface protrudes outwards and can be easily grasped by the fingers of an operator.
  • the one or at least one of the two openings is designed such that it allows the lateral pushing through to assemble the adjusting screw or the adjusting nut.
  • the adjusting screw or adjusting nut is mounted so as to be axially non-displaceably rotatable on both end faces in the housing.
  • the housing except the internal thread for the stud with a first thread pitch (first threaded connection) with a further (second) threaded connection between the guide surfaces forming part and the screwed onto the stud bolt part of the rod guide with a second , provided larger thread pitch.
  • the further threaded connection can also be formed by a guide surface part with external thread and a stud part with internal thread.
  • the further threaded connection can alternatively by a guide surface part with Internal thread and a stud part with external thread be formed.
  • the roughened or grooved or prismatic surface may be formed between the guide surface part and the threaded connection part.
  • the threads can also be arranged so that they both act in the same direction upon rotation of the nut with non-rotatable guide surface part.
  • the housing forms an undercut receiving space for mounting the adjusting screw or nut, which in turn has a shaft stub which can be inserted laterally into the receiving space and has a projecting ring for receiving in the undercut in a tongue and groove manner.
  • the receiving space may have a funnel-shaped access with resilient funnel walls for guiding the undercut portion of the stub shaft with an adjoining the funnel circular area for pivotal mounting of the undercut, a circular cross-section forming part of the stub shaft.
  • Yet another embodiment of the rod guide is characterized in that a retaining lug is arranged at the funnel entrance, which prevents or makes it difficult to push out the stub shaft from the bearing.
  • the housing and / or the adjusting screw or nut can be made of plastic (in particular PA, polyamide).

L'invention concerne un guide de tiges (10) servant à guider des tiges de verrouillage (12, 14) sur des portes d'armoire en tôle (16) ou similaire, comprenant un support (18) qui peut être fixé, par exemple soudé par points, sur la surface intérieure (26) du vantail de porte (16), et un élément de guidage (20) qui peut être monté sur le support (18) et qui constitue un boîtier (20) muni d'une surface de guidage (22) dont l'espacement (24) par rapport à la surface intérieure (26) du vantail de porte (16) lorsque la tige est montée est réglable. Le support (18) soudé par points au vantail de porte (16) est un boulon d'entretoisement ou un boulon à souder muni d'un filetage périphérique (28). Une vis de réglage ou un écrou de réglage (30) est ou peut être vissé sur le boulon d'entretoisement (18) et la vis de réglage ou l'écrou de réglage (30) est supporté en rotation dans le boîtier ou l'élément de guidage (20). La vis de réglage ou l'écrou de réglage (30) présente une surface périphérique (36) accessible de l'extérieur, rendue rugueuse ou cannelée ou encore biseautée pour tourner la vis de réglage ou l'écrou de réglage (30) à la main.
